My 7 and 1/2 year old son has been here since he was 6 years old twice a week for an hour every week. The level of dedication and attention is nothing short of amazing. Small classes and one on one time being a smaller school is a plus. Rick is very easy going but strict , which is what I wanted for my son. Teaching my son respect and self confidence seems to be top goals at the school. I would highly recommend without a doubt for any parent who is looking for an activity for their kid that pays back so much.

It is a big decision to join a Martial Arts school. The head instructor is everything. Sifu Cropper and the other students made us feel welcome. We love our Kajukenbo because there are 5 arts in one. Great job and thank you for teaching our children self defense.

My sister and I have been training with Sifu Rick Cropper for the past 9 years and continue to be students of his. He's the best teacher out there and really knows his stuff. He works with his students individually to help them succeed in the Art. He pushes his students and truly cares about them as if they were his own family. He's extremely respectful and loves to have fun. He goes above and beyond for his students and helps them every little step of the way. He makes sure that everyone stays safe and in a good mood all throughout class. No one is ever left behind. The whole school works through material together and everyone helps each other. He goes into great detail and depth to help the students better understand the curriculum as well as get more involved and more excited about it. If you're looking to find a place to train at, now you've found it. Although now it's called Rick Cropper Martial Art Center and located at 8040 ste B SE Stark St. Portland, OR

I've been at the school for a while now. Since then I've earned my Black Belt and I still continue to come to classes, because despite the immense amount of material and training required to earn your black Belt, Sifu Cropper still has so much more to impart on his students. Classes are always fresh and it's rare when you feel stuck, especially with all the individual attention you receive. If you want to learn or specialize in something you are given that opportunity! You are never lost in the back of the class like many other schools (Martial arts and beyond) you are acknowledged and your development always seems to be a priority. Sifu Earnestly wants you to succeed. The school is small, but we are all warm and welcoming. You're pretty much guaranteed to have a great time.
